This baldness issue is a special type of alopecia areata in which your own immune system cells attack the skin cells. More particularly hair follicles in the beard area. Alopecia is an autoimmune disease that causes hair to loose in small patches. The condition has a sudden onset that causes beard hair loss and leads to the appearance of circular bald patches in your beard region. The disease can be also termed as spot baldness.
Even though it can be treated by various medications but its autoimmune nature makes it liable to return. Therefore facial hair transplant appears to be its one stop and happy solution.
As the name suggests, it is simply a hair transplantation done to the facial hairs. A beard transplant requires extraction of hair from other parts of the body such as scalp hair and transplanted into areas which have circular bald patches in your beard.
These procedures are minimally invasive, cause minute pain and their recovery time is of shorter duration. Compared to other surgeries and transplant it may take around 5 hours. Concisely, one day off from work will just do the job provided that you have to schedule it beforehand!
There are two methods of Facial Hair Transplant available;
The FUE hair transplant is the most commonly employed procedure which requires removal of individual hair along with their follicles and then there placement in the designated area in your beard. Usually hairs are removed from the back of the scalp region or nape of the neck. A hair surgery made with the FUE will leave small circular scars. Mainly in the part where hairs were removed from but they are hardly visible even in shorter hair.
In this method of beard transplant, individual follicular units are taken and are grafted one by one from the donor site to a recipient site. The follicular unit survival upon extraction is what makes it most successful. The procedure is done under a local anesthetic and you will feel minute or even no pain at times. This practice is absolutely safe and also has the advantage of less recovery time.
A FUT procedure requires removal of a small hear bearing strips of tissues from a region and stitching of the wounded area, leaving a linear scar on the donor surface. These strips are taken from the scalp, at the back of the head.
With this technique an ample amount of hair is taken thus a large number of grafts are available for transplant. It is also painless like FUE and is done under local anesthetic. It is typically less expensive and has a shorter duration of surgery. Unfortunately, the end results are not as natural as with the more recent FUE method.
Grafts that are usually selected for a transplant are healthy and genetically resistant to balding, like the back of the head. Numbers of grafts that are needed to be transplanted depends upon the size of the recipient area. Amount of grafts required to restore beard hair vary with the treatment. Studies suggests an approximate of 2500 hair follicle grafts is needed for full beard.
A successful FUE treatment requires 2000 or more separate hair graft extractions. On the other hand in a FUT procedure a hair bearing tissue strip is excised as a whole and individual follicular unit grafts are obtained.
Beard transplants will last and look absolutely natural if done the right way. After two to three weeks of the treatment, in both FUE and FUT, you will experience hair loss for sometimes. This is called Shock hair loss and is very natural and a part of recovery. Do not fret as new and healthy hair will grow back by three months or in a particular timeframe as advised by your doctor.
The cost of both FUE and FUT procedures is different and is due to the nature of both procedures. The duration of surgeries, technicalities, area to be covered or the density of your beard add up in the expense of the treatment. A FUE hair surgery happens to be more expensive than its FUT counterpart as it requires individual hair excision that demands a skilled surgeon. Plus added to this, is its time duration for a surgery.
